The firm will draw a credit history record to recognize what you owe and the degree of your difficulty. If the mercy program is the finest solution, the counselor will certainly send you a contract that details the strategy, consisting of the quantity of the monthly payment.

As soon as everybody concurs, you begin making regular monthly repayments on a 36-month plan. When it mores than, the agreed-to quantity is removed. There's no charge for paying off the balance early, but no expansions are allowed. If you miss out on a settlement, the agreement is nullified, and you need to leave the program. Because the program allows customers to clear up for less than what they owe, the creditors that get involved desire reassurance that those that benefit from it would not have the ability to pay the complete amount. Your credit report card accounts likewise should be from financial institutions and charge card companies that have actually concurred to participate.

Equilibrium has to go to the very least $1,000.Agreed-the balance must be settled in 36 months. There are no expansions. If you miss out on a payment that's simply one missed out on settlement the agreement is terminated. Your lender(s) will certainly cancel the plan and your equilibrium returns to the original amount, minus what you've paid while in the program.

Charge card mercy is created to set you back the consumer much less, repay the debt quicker, and have less drawbacks than its for-profit equivalent. Some crucial areas of difference between Charge card Financial debt Forgiveness and for-profit debt negotiation are: Charge card Financial debt Forgiveness programs have partnerships with financial institutions who have actually consented to take part.

Once they do, the reward duration starts right away. For-profit debt settlement programs work out with each creditor, usually over a 2-3-year duration, while passion, fees and calls from financial obligation collectors proceed. This implies a larger hit on your credit rating report and credit scores rating, and an increasing equilibrium up until negotiation is completed.

Credit Card Financial obligation Forgiveness clients make 36 equivalent regular monthly repayments to eliminate their financial debt. For-profit financial debt settlement clients pay into an escrow account over a settlement duration toward a lump amount that will be paid to lenders.

Enrollment in a Charge Card Financial debt Mercy stops phone calls and letters from financial obligation collection and recovery companies for the accounts consisted of in the program.



For-profit debt negotiation programs don't stop collection actions until the lump-sum repayment is made to the creditor. Nonprofit Charge Card Financial obligation Mercy programs will tell you in advance what the regular monthly charge is, topped at $75, or much less, depending upon what state you reside in. For-profit debt settlement firms may not be clear concerning fee quantities, which commonly are a percent of the equilibrium.

In many situations, financial obligation loan consolidation additionally comes with a lower rate of interest than what you were paying on your credit cards, making the regular monthly costs, in addition to general expenses, less. Charge card financial obligation combination's most usual forms are financial debt management strategies, debt loan consolidation financings, or a zero-interest transfer charge card.

To get a financial obligation consolidation lending or a zero-interest balance transfer charge card, you require a debt score of at the very least 680. In many cases greater. If your accounts are charged off, your credit history is likely well listed below that. Credit history isn't an aspect for financial obligation management program, yet you require an adequate income to be able to make a monthly payment that will cover all of the accounts included in the program.

Insolvency will certainly remove all qualified unprotected debt. Credit Score Card Financial obligation Forgiveness will certainly have a negative influence on your credit scores score because complete balances on accounts were not paid.

Charge Card Debt Mercy settlements start as quickly as you're approved into the program. Insolvency approval and discharge can take 6-12 months. Collection actions and claims on Charge card Debt Mercy customers are quit once creditors accept the strategy. Declare personal bankruptcy activates an automatic remain on collection actions and legal actions, and provides defense from harassment by creditors, yet if the court does not approve the insolvency, those will launch once again.
